Explanation:-
Molality= Moles per Kg of solvent.
Molar mass of ethylene glycol= 62.07 g/ mol.
Number of moles of ethylene glycol= 82.2g / (62.07 g/mol)
= 1.324 moles
Density of water = 1 g/ml = (1/1000kg)/ (1/1000litre)
= 1 Kg / litre
Mass of 1.5 litre of water = 1.5 litre x 1 kg / litre
= 1.5 kg
Molality of ethylene glycol = 1.324 moles/1.5 kg
= 0.883 m

Boiling: The process of conversion from liquid to gas on heating is called boiling.
Example: Water on heating turns into water vapour.
Melting: The process of conversion from solid to liquid at room temperature is called melting.
Example: Ice cream melting at room temperature.
Sublimation: The Conversion of solid to gas directly is called sublimation.
Example: Camphor, Dry ice

To have a high electrical conductivity, a normal metal should have mobile valence electrons and a long electron mean free path.
Explanation:
A long mean free path means that the electron goes a long distance between scattering events.
